What They Do
Alternative Heat focuses on offsite prefabricated mechanical, electrical, and plumbing (MEP) systems, specializing in decarbonization solutions through modern construction methods. With over 19 years of experience, the company has established itself as a market leader in commercial offsite fabrication, providing a range of services including design, fabrication, supply, installation, and commissioning of bespoke modular MEP solutions (source: growjo.com). Their offerings include renewable heating systems such as biomass boilers, ground source heat pumps, air source heat pumps, and solar panels, catering to domestic, commercial, and industrial applications. As an MCS-registered supplier, they ensure high standards in their products and services (source: zoominfo.com). The company operates from facilities equipped with advanced technology and ample workshop space, supported by a skilled workforce including design engineers and CAD technicians (source: growjo.com). Their target markets span the public and private sectors across the UK, Ireland, and Europe, focusing on scalable, high-quality turnkey projects that align with carbon reduction and net zero goals (source: youtube.com).

Recent Developments
In the financial year ending 31 March 2024, Alternative Heat reported a significant turnover increase to £46.9 million, marking a 48% rise from the previous year (source: endole.co.uk). Employee growth has also been notable, with numbers reaching approximately 206, reflecting a 37% increase (source: endole.co.uk). A promotional video released on 17 July 2025 highlighted the company's role in decarbonization and modular MEP, showcasing their scalable solutions and European reach (source: youtube.com). Corporate filings have included full accounts submitted for the year ending 31 March 2023, with updates on confirmation statements and changes in significant control details (source: endole.co.uk). However, there have been no major contracts, acquisitions, or awards reported in the last two years, indicating a focus on internal growth and operational stability (source: endole.co.uk).

Role Overview
We are seeking an experienced and commercially astute Contracts Manager to take responsibility for the delivery of decarbonisation and building upgrade projects across Ireland. With a clear electrical bias, together with a solid mechanical understanding, the role will lead the management of electrical building services packages, provide direction to project delivery teams, and ensure works are executed safely, to programme, within budget, and to the highest quality standards. The successful candidate will work closely with the commercial project management team, in-house M&E design function, and senior operational stakeholders to deliver a range of low-carbon and energy efficiency projects, including MV/LV distribution upgrades, Solar PV installations, LED lighting upgrades, Controls and BMS-related works, and wider building fabric improvement projects. Operating across live commercial and public sector environments, this role demands strong contractual and commercial awareness, decisive leadership, and the ability to manage client expectations, project risk, and multidisciplinary stakeholders throughout the full project lifecycle.
What You'll be Doing
This role is responsible for leading the successful delivery of electrical projects from inception through to completion, ensuring all works are completed safely, on schedule, within budget, and to the required quality and compliance standards. The position acts as the primary day-to-day client contact, managing relationships, coordinating project activities, and overseeing planning, risk management, resource allocation, procurement, and commercial performance. Working closely with Operations, Commercial, Procurement, and delivery teams, the role ensures effective project controls, cost forecasting, subcontractor management, change control, and performance reporting. It also drives continuous improvement, supports workforce planning and capability development, and oversees project close-out activities, including testing, commissioning, certification, documentation, and client handover, ensuring successful project outcomes and client satisfaction.
